How long does a taxi take from Lingfield to Gatwick?

Most journeys take around 25- 45 minutes, depending on your pickup point and traffic. If you’re travelling during peak times, it’s smart to allow extra buffer time.

  • Typical time: 30–40 minutes
  • Rush hour: allow extra time for local roads and airport approach traffic
  • Early morning: usually the most predictable

Bottom line: Plan for 30–40 minutes, and add a safety buffer if it’s busy.

Which vehicle should I book for Lingfield to Gatwick?

Picking the right vehicle is one of the easiest ways to avoid last-minute problems. If you’re unsure, it’s usually better to size up.

Saloon (standard car)

Best for 1–3 passengers with light-to-average luggage.

Estate (extra luggage space)

Ideal if you have bigger suitcases or you’d like more boot room.

MPV / people carrier (groups and families)

Best for families, groups, or anyone travelling with lots of luggage.

Bottom line: The right vehicle keeps the trip comfortable and avoids delays on pickup.

What time should I book my taxi to arrive at Gatwick?

Most people aim to arrive 2- 3 hours before departure (depending on the airline and destination). Work backwards from that target, then add a buffer for traffic.
